Multiple choice

Which among the following statements does not characterise the process of fermentation in winemaking?

  1. During fermentation, heat is produced.

  2. If the temperature is kept below fermentation point for a day or two, then the maceration of wine takes place.

  3. Wild yeast begins the fermentation immediately.

  4. The yeast also produces esters and other compounds, which contribute to the wine’s fruity aromas.

  5. It is a common practice to add a sufficiently large dose of a single strain of yeast to start the fermentation.

Explanation

Wild yeast can take up to a week to begin the fermentation because their initial populations are small compared to an inoculated fermentation.
